The Short Answer: Not Really, But...

Let's be honest, getting into any university involves a certain level of effort. It's not like you can just waltz in wearing sweatpants and a "Good Vibes Only" t-shirt. But compared to some of its Ivy League counterparts, University of Houston is definitely more welcoming.

The Long Answer: It Depends

  • Your Major Matters: If you're aiming for engineering or business, expect a slightly tougher competition. These programs are popular, and the university wants to maintain its standards. But don't let that discourage you!
  • Your Academics Count: Good grades are your golden ticket. A solid GPA, coupled with decent standardized test scores, is your best bet. Remember, it's not about being a genius; it's about showing consistency.
  • Extracurriculars: The Cherry on Top: While not mandatory, extracurricular activities can give your application that extra oomph. Whether it's volunteering, playing a sport, or leading a club, it shows you're a well-rounded individual.

How to Increase Your Chances of Getting into University of Houston

  • How to improve your GPA: Focus on core subjects, seek help when needed, and develop effective study habits.
  • How to prepare for standardized tests: Practice regularly, take advantage of prep courses, and manage test anxiety.
  • How to write a compelling essay: Be genuine, tell a story, and proofread carefully.
  • How to build a strong extracurricular profile: Explore your interests, take on leadership roles, and document your involvement.
  • How to choose the right major: Research different fields, consider your passions, and explore career options.
